Output 65ced56e6df38fbf90526bd77bf74e70ed9fb84686d008c0b4d1faa3e9b68b4f:0

value
83673
script pubkey
OP_0 OP_PUSHBYTES_20 8089b473cbcf453ba7f7521868331685fb38b92d
address
bc1qszymgu7teaznhflh2gvxsvckshan3wfdg3dzwf
transaction
65ced56e6df38fbf90526bd77bf74e70ed9fb84686d008c0b4d1faa3e9b68b4f
confirmations
24990
spent
true